    Well, I'm a Baptist, but I come from PA Dutch / Lutheran roots. So my daughter and I made up a batch of potato donuts last night just because this was Fastnacht Day!

    But, I have been known to go meatless on Fridays and particularly on Good Friday. My husband was brought up Lutheran and requests that we do so on Good Friday because "it's the right thing to do." So I have always honored that.

    Do I think it matters to God? In the strict sense, no. But then anything we do that acknowledges the Lord's sacrifice, and brings it to our recollection, is surely of some value to US.
